Women's Basketball Outlasts Limestone, 70-60

1/22/2009 12:00:00 AM

Four Lady Crusaders reached double figures as the Belmont Abbey women's basketball team earned a 70-60 win over the visiting Limestone Lady Saints. Belmont Abbey, winners of three of its last four, improves to 9-5 overall and 7-2 in Conference Carolinas, while Limestone slips to 7-8 overall and 5-5 in Conference Carolinas.

The Abbey, which never trailed after the opening minute, shot 38.5 percent (20-52) from the floor as sophomore forward Shayla Jackson led the way with 16 points and seven rebounds. She also had three assists and two steals. Junior guard Courtney Naquin added 15 points on five of 11 shooting from the field, while guard Ashley Giddens added 14 points on five of ten shooting from the field, including a four for seven effort from beyond the arc. She added three assists and a pair of steals. Freshman Paula Regalado came off the bench to score 11 points in 13 minutes, converting three of her six field goal attempts and five of six free throw attempts. She added six rebounds as the Lady Crusaders won the battle of the boards 39-33.

Limestone shot 32.1 percent (17-53) as Bianca Gonazelez led all scorers with 22 points on six of 17 shooting from the field, while dishing out three assists and collecting a pair of steals. Tierney Burdett added 17 points and six rebounds. Lauren Pace led all players with six assists, half of the Lady Saints team total.

Belmont Abbey is back in action Saturday night at 5:30 when it heads to Charlotte to face Queens. That game will take place at the Grady Cole Center.
